Fault
Cause
Remedy
The pressure washer
switches off while in
operation.
The plug of the connecting cord or
extension cord has been pulled out of
the socket.
► Plug in mains plug of connecting
cord or extension cord.
The circuit-breaker (fuse) or the resi‐
dual current circuit breaker has trip‐
ped. There is an electrical overload or
a fault in the circuit.
► Look for cause of tripping and
remedy it. Engage circuit-breaker
(fuse) or the residual current circuit
breaker.
► Switch off other loads connected to
the same circuit.
The fuse rating of the socket is too
low.
► Plug the connecting cable into a
socket with the correct fuse rating,
The electric motor is too warm.
► Allow the pressure washer to cool
for 5 minutes.
► Clean the nozzle.
The high-pressure
pump repeatedly
switches on and off
without squeezing the
spray gun trigger.
There is a leak in the high-pressure
pump, high-pressure hose or spray
attachment.
► Ask a STIHL servicing dealer to
inspect the pressure washer.
The working pressure
fluctuates or drops.
There is not enough water.
► Open water tap fully.
► Make sure that a sufficient quantity
of water is available.
The nozzle is blocked.
► Clean the nozzle.
The water intake screen or water filter
is blocked.
► Clean water intake screen and water
filter.
The high-pressure pump, high-press‐
ure hose or spray attachment is lea‐
king or faulty.
► Ask a STIHL servicing dealer to
inspect the pressure washer.
The shape of the
water jet has chan‐
ged.
The nozzle is blocked.
► Clean the nozzle.
The nozzle is worn.
► Fit a new nozzle.
Detergent is no lon‐
ger sucked in.
The detergent container is empty.
► Fill the detergent bottle with cleaning
agent.
The filter in the detergent bottle is dirty. ► Rinse out the filter under running
water.
Connections with
pressure washer,
high-pressure hose,
spray gun or spray
lance are stiff.
The gaskets of the connections have
not been greased.
► Lubricate the gaskets. 17.2
The LED "BATTERY
INDICATION" flashes
red.
The batteries in the control panel are
empty.
► Install new batteries in the control
panel.
The activation key
flashes green.
The connection between the pressure
washer and the control panel no longer
exists.
► Switch off the high-pressure washer.
► Reduce the distance between the
spray gun and the pressure washer.
► Switch on the pressure washer and
the control panel.
